The Division 2 has done it again - this time with an unexpected, web-slinging twist. Not content with the Assassin's Creed Easter egg that may well have given away the location of the next title in Ubisoft's long-standing franchise, it looks like a Division 2 Spider-Man Easter egg is also an actual thing which has been noticed by Insomniac Games, no less.

Spider-Man was a smash hit when it launched last year, selling over 9 million copies in a few short months after release. After the game's wealth of DLC and its internet popularity, there were perhaps surprisingly few crossover events with other major titles to capitalize on that. While this definitely isn't a crossover by any means, the Division 2 Spider-Man Easter egg is still a nice tribute.

The team at Insomniac Games, the minds behind Spider-Man, took to Twitter with footage of someone finding the Division 2 Spider-Man Easter egg. From the video, you can clearly see that the Easter egg is a backpack webbed to a wall. Players can shoot off the webbing and debris to free it, a callback to the way that Peter Parker interacts with these in the Spider-Man game. The backpacks are an iconic part of the web-slinging hero's arsenal, and there's a little wink and a nudge here from Ubisoft in using them as the Easter egg in The Division 2; they're the richest source of Easter eggs in Spider-Man.

The Division 2 Spider-Man Easter egg is pretty neat, and yet another example of Ubisoft paying homage to a popular title (though not necessarily one from the company's stable). Ubisoft is no stranger to these sorts of callbacks in titles in its own games, considering that it hinted at Watch Dogs 3's location in Watch Dogs 2. Since players are clearly still finding these little treats scattered throughout the game, it's highly likely that there's still more homages and Easter eggs that have yet to be discovered, potentially to do with other AAA games.
